The cost for an emergency locksmith service varies widely based on location, time, and the specific issue. A typical emergency call-out fee for a residential lockout during standard hours might range from $50 to $100. However, for late-night, weekend, or holiday service, this fee can increase to $100 to $200 or more. The total charge includes this fee plus labor and any parts, such as a new lock or key. A simple car door unlock might cost $75 to $150, while a more complex home lock rekeying or replacement during an emergency could be $150 to $300+. Always request an upfront estimate and ensure the locksmith is licensed and bonded to avoid scams. Industry standards dictate transparency in pricing.
When deciding between a locksmith and a dealership for automotive key services, a locksmith is almost always the more cost-effective choice. Dealerships typically charge premium rates for parts and labor, especially for programming modern transponder keys or smart keys, and may require towing the vehicle to their location. A professional mobile locksmith can often come to you, provide service on the spot, and source aftermarket or OEM-equivalent keys at a lower cost. For standard house lockouts or rekeying, a locksmith is also generally less expensive. However, for highly specialized proprietary security systems on some new vehicles, consulting the dealer might be necessary, but a reputable automotive locksmith can handle most jobs for a fraction of the price.
The cost to unlock a lock varies significantly based on the service required. For a simple residential lockout, a locksmith may charge between $50 and $150, depending on the time of day and your location. Opening a car door typically ranges from $75 to $200, while unlocking a commercial-grade safe or high-security system can cost several hundred dollars. Emergency or after-hours calls incur premium rates. It's crucial to get an upfront estimate from a reputable, licensed professional to avoid scams. The cost to replace a door lock varies based on the lock type, brand, and labor. A basic entry-grade doorknob or deadbolt can range from $50 to $150 for parts and professional installation. High-security locks, smart locks, or commercial-grade hardware can cost $200 to $500 or more. Labor typically adds $75 to $150 per hour, with a standard replacement often taking under an hour.
